A 5719 New Jersey General Assembly · 2024-2025 Regular Session

Broadens scope of information sharing and civil immunity therefor, related to insurance fraud.

This bill broadens information sharing about insurance fraud by expanding definitions of "insurance-support organization" and "privileged information" to cover more types of information sharing. It allows insurance companies, agents, and related organizations to share more information about individuals or entities with law enforcement, other insurers, and fraud prevention organizations when investigating potential fraud. The bill also expands civil immunity protections for those sharing information in good faith, covering more types of legal claims than before. These changes aim to strengthen New Jersey's ability to detect and prevent insurance fraud by facilitating better information flow between the insurance industry and law enforcement.
